Town Officials List for Burgess and Rankin Administration

Compiled roster names for Burgess W. A. Rankin and officers across town government. Included are council members Robt MacKay Wm Seehnar A A Davis C Smith P J Bayer J W Lee W S Leffard A Mintzer Jas R King, Clerk C H Meacham, Surveyor Geo C Hamilton, School Directors Rankin Clark Dinsmoor Siegfried Hazeltine Langworthy, Assessor C H Meacham, Justices Geo O Cornelius J F McPherson, Constable A S Dalrymple, Fire Chief E Windsor, Assts Will Allan Al Spinner, Notaries D J Ball H E Brown Dinsmoor C F Hoffman Ozro Nesmith W D Hinckley.

County Officials List for Warren Area

A complete roster of county offices and incumbents including Congressman W L Scott Erie state senator O C Allen Warren assembly Henry Brace Warren president judge W D Brown Warren associate judges J Z Barker Bear Lake and C C Merritt Grand Valley sheriff Robert A Love Warren prothonotary D A Arird Warren register and recorder W J Alexander Warren treasurer Geo F Yates Warren county commissioners M Crocker Youngsville T L Putnam Russell Joseph Clinton Sheffield clerk A A Cogswell surveyor D F A Wheelock Lottsville coroner Dr F W Whitcomb Warren district attorney G H Higgins Warren auditors N P Curtis Conewango WW O Martin Elk F E Fay Farmington county supt T W Arird Warren Pa.

Irrigation Has Transformed Stanford Ranch at Vina

A reporter visits Senator Stanford's vast Vina ranch to witness its transformation from a barren plain to a thriving agricultural and equine empire. Flooded alfalfa fields and extensive vineyards define the landscape, with a 3500 acre world‑class vineyard and a two‑acre winery under construction. Horses, Holsteins, and a planned training track on adjoining Copeland estate showcase varied riches, while the brick wine facility and grand residence epitomize the ranch's scale and ambition.
